Find the value of the following :
`|87| div |-87| =`____________

To solve the problem \( |87| \div |-87| \), we can follow these steps: ### Step 1: Understand the concept of modulus The modulus (or absolute value) of a number is its distance from zero on the number line, regardless of direction. Therefore, the modulus of any number is always non-negative. ### Step 2: Calculate \( |87| \) Since 87 is a positive number, the modulus of 87 is simply: \[ |87| = 87 \] ### Step 3: Calculate \( |-87| \) For -87, which is a negative number, the modulus is: \[ |-87| = 87 \] This is because the modulus of a negative number is the same as the modulus of its positive counterpart. ### Step 4: Divide the two results Now we can substitute the values we found into the expression: \[ |87| \div |-87| = 87 \div 87 \] ### Step 5: Simplify the division Calculating \( 87 \div 87 \) gives: \[ 87 \div 87 = 1 \] ### Final Answer Thus, the value of \( |87| \div |-87| \) is: \[ \boxed{1} \] ---
